Helmut Lent victory 6 July 1941

Hello,
I am trying to research a combat report I have for a Whitley (of No.10 Squadron?) that was shot down at about 00:56 hours on the 6th July 1941 by an aircraft flown by Helmut Lent of NJG1. I believe two of the crew were found dead with the aircraft but any information about the crew would be very gratefully received. If anyone has a copy of Chorley for 1941, this may be what I am looking for.

Re: Helmut Lent victory 6 July 1941

All four crew were killed, and are buried in Hardenberg Cemetery
P/O R Goulding
Sgt D Morrison
Sgt R H Jordan
F/S R I H Aird

You can use the CWGC website's database to find their full names.
